how to implement NSO command devices device device-name live-status xpon-stats:exec show running-config-interface if-name in Java

Hi all,

I have to implement a java service which executes the following command:

devices device deviceName live-status xpon-stats:exec show running-config-interface xgei-xx/xx/xx

 

This is  java code to implement the first part of the command:

 

  NavuContainer devContainer =ncsRoot.container("devices").list("device").elem(oltName);
  NavuContainer liveStatusContainer =devContainer.container("live-status");
  NavuContainer execContainer= liveStatusContainer.container("xpon-stats:exec");

  NavuAction actionShow = execContainer.action("show");

 

Unfortunately I can't find java API that can be used to add parameters to action show.

I know in Python it is possible to invoke the command by passing the input object into the device.live_status.ios_stats__exec.show() method in this way:

 

with ncs.maapi.Maapi() as m:
with ncs.maapi.Session(m, 'admin', 'python'):
root = ncs.maagic.get_root(m)
device = root.devices.device[device_name]
input1 = device.live_status.ios_stats__exec.show.get_input()
input1.args = [command]
output = device.live_status.ios_stats__exec.show(input1).result
print(output)

Can anybody help me to do the same in Java?

Thanks in advance for any contribution!

Hello,

 

in the configuration guide you have an example on how to use an NavuAction with parameters (nso_development guide) - in the section Java API Overview / NAVU API - at the bottom of the page. The paramaters are passed using the ConfXMLParam structure.

 

From the page:

        NavuAction ping = if.action(interfaces.i_ping_test_);


        /*
         * Execute action.
         */
        ConfXMLParamResult[] result = ping.call(new ConfXMLParam[] {
                new ConfXMLParamValue(new interfaces().hash(),
                                      interfaces._ttl,
                                      new ConfInt64(64))};

        //or we could execute it with XML-String

        result = ping.call("<if:ttl>64</if:ttl>");
